Vietnam Active Protection System Market Segmentation

By Type: The segmentation of the market by type includes Hard Kill Systems, Soft Kill Systems, Hybrid Systems, and Others. Hard Kill Systems are designed to physically destroy incoming threats, while Soft Kill Systems aim to confuse or mislead them. Hybrid Systems combine both approaches, providing a comprehensive defense solution. The Others category encompasses various innovative technologies that do not fit neatly into the previous classifications. Growth Drivers

Increasing Defense Budgets: Vietnam's defense budget has seen a significant increase, reaching approximately $7.0 billion in future, up from $6.5 billion in previous year. This growth reflects the government's commitment to enhancing military capabilities amid regional tensions. The rising budget allows for investments in advanced technologies, including active protection systems, which are crucial for modernizing the armed forces and ensuring national security against evolving threats. Rising Security Threats: The geopolitical landscape in Southeast Asia has become increasingly volatile, with rising tensions in the South China Sea. In future, Vietnam faces heightened security threats, prompting a strategic shift towards advanced defense solutions. The government has identified active protection systems as essential for safeguarding military assets, leading to increased demand for these technologies to counter potential aggressions and enhance deterrence capabilities. Technological Advancements: The rapid pace of technological innovation in defense systems is a key driver for Vietnam's active protection system market. In future, adv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ning are expected to enhance system effectiveness, enabling real-time threat assessment and response. This technological evolution not only improves operational efficiency but also attracts investments from both domestic and international defense contractors looking to collaborate on cutting-edge solutions.

Market Challenges

High Initial Investment Costs: The deployment of active protection systems requires substantial initial investments, often exceeding $1.2 million per unit. This financial barrier can deter smaller defense contractors and limit the adoption of these systems within the Vietnamese military. As the government seeks to modernize its forces, balancing budget constraints with the need for advanced technologies remains a significant challenge in future. Limited Awareness and Understanding: Despite the growing importance of active protection systems, there remains a lack of awareness and understanding among key stakeholders in Vietnam. Many military officials and decision-makers are not fully informed about the capabilities and benefits of these systems. This knowledge gap can hinder effective procurement processes and slow down the integration of advanced technologies into the defense strategy, impacting overall military readiness.
